Mens Varsity Basketball vs. West Forsyth HS School

Game Date
Dec 7, 2018
Score
COWBOYS: 72
WEST FORSYTH HIGH SCHOOL: 33

The Cowboys were on the road again and headed over to square off against the Titans of West Forsyth. These two teams have had some solid battles in the last few years, and Southwest has managed to come out victorious in those three contests. This season the Titans are struggling out of the gate. West Forsyth came into tonight's tilt after a second half comeback at home fell just short to remain win-less on the season. The Cowboys are still trying to piece things together while maintaining their win streak. The Cowboys came out hungry and jumped out to an early 7-0 lead. The Titans responded with a 4-0 spurt of their own to cut it to 7-4 at the 3:50 mark. The Cowboys forced the tempo and in a blink they had a 13-0 run and it was 20-4. West Forsyth stopped the bleeding momentarily with a basket with 40 seconds to go, but the Cowboys went the length of the court and finished the frame with another bucket, closing it at 22-6. Southwest opened the scoring in the second quarter as well but the Titans matched it and it was 24-8. Another 9-0 run by the Cowboys pushed it out to 33-8 by the 4:12 mark. A pair of made free throws by the Titans stopped the run. But that only started another 8-0 run that made it 41-10. The last ninety seconds of the half were back and forth and it was 45-15. The third quarter was more defensive pressure and more easy baskets. The margin crossed the 40 point threshold with 4:40 to go in the frame at 59-19. The rest of the frame and the rest of the game ended in a blur, as the Cowboys bench played a solid second half to help the visiting Cowboys roll to a convincing 72-33 win. Leading the way for the Titans was Tyler Beckner with 11 points. Southwest got great contributions on both sides of the ball from the whole roster. Offensive leaders on the night were: Kobe Langley with (19 points, 6 Asts, 2 Stls), Jay’Den Turner with (16 points, 6 Rebs, 3 Asts), Joel Pettiford with (16 points, 8 Rebs), and Christian Martin with (10 points, 5 Rebs).
